Showing you how to thread a machine There are lots of different sewing machines available to buy in shops. However they all are basically the same when it comes to threading them up. I’ll explain how to do it in stages.

Using the sewing machine A close up of the front of the machine At the end of this lesson you will have learnt: learn how to use the sewing machine safely main parts of the sewing machine how to thread a sewing machine

Take up arm Guide plate Presser foot On closer inspection this is what the front of your machine will look like. These are the main elements to the front of the machine no matter what make you have Bobbin

Zig – Zag stitch dial Needle position - should always be in middle Buttonhole dial Straight stitch dial and reverse. These dials are important as they control the type and size of the machine stitches.

Threading a sewing machine Follow the steps to thread your machine – you cannot miss out any of the steps !

The foot control - (pedal) this is how you make the sewing machine stitch. You need to take note of the following : your heel must be on the floor. Press the foot control with the middle of your foot. Safety Never press the foot control down quickly – slowly. Never press another persons foot while they are using it.
